Top 10 Music Artists On Twitter










Earlier this month I wrote an article where I talked about the Top 10 NBA Players On Twitter and saw a huge response from it. Twitter has played such a huge part in the way people brand themselves online that it seems appropriate that we rank the Top 10 Music Artists on Twitter.
Factors that went into the metrics for the rankings include the number of followers, the number of updates they have, as well as how many times they were retweeted as of May 19, 2009. While many may argue that the number of followers should reflect ones ranking, that is not necessarily true. Although someone may have a large number of followers, it is the tweets of the individual that people are most interested in.
While we only featured the Top 10, more and more musicians are using Twitter to build up their fan base as well as increase the community around them. If you don’t see your favorite artist on the list, that means that they need your support! One important thing that you should look at when deciding which music artists you want to follow is the number of updates that they have. Typically, the more updates they have, the more involved they are with their fans.
So without further ado, here are the Top 10 Music Artists On Twitter:
